So true... self confindence contibutes to the mental game. Having said that, some of my best bowhunting years were when I was younger. My only camo was my hat(John Deere of course), blue jeans, and a five brothers flannel shirt tucked in as to not get in the way of the draw.Usually I went right to the tree from work smelling like grease and sweat. Some nights ended with does busting me, but many were successful hunts. Successful meaning I saw deer throughout the hunt, and enjoyed myself. I killed just as many deer hunting "farmer style", as I did when bowhunting started becoming more mainstream. I to felt it was a must to have all of the bells and whistles hanging off of me to sucessfully kill a buck. There is no doubt thatcamo helps from being silloetted in the tree. I don't care what kind of scent block orcover sprays you put on. If the windconditions are wrong, chances are you'll get busted. Hunt the wind to the best of your abilities, wear some camo that's quiet, keep your hunting clothes outside in the clean air, and invest in a good pair of rubber boots. As you continue to hunt through the years, you will be the judge of what is necessity and what is not. Good luck.
